Mamluks were trained then manumitted by their master, whereas Janissaries were lifelong slaves I believe. Mamluks in the Mamluk Sultanate could not only become Sultan but were also the major Amirs, who in turn could own, raise, and lead their own army of Mamluks.
The Janissaries belonged to the Ottoman Sultan only, and were not elevated to the ranks of governors or princes, I think.
